does anyone have any experiences around people/relatives/family/friends with Pluto Square ASC?

i was looking on google, here was some ones interpretation, i was wondering if people felt this way around pluto square asc'ers?

Pluto square ascendant indicates that you are never a kind of person who would be fond of superficiality . Everything that you are interested in needs to be deep and meaningful for you. Even for the things that seem irrelevant , you also want to get deep into their root to figure out all the hidden messages even though there are none.

With Pluto square Ascendant , you are inclined to be a loner , or at least it is very challenging for you to reach out to people without making them feel intimidated , or people find a hard time figuring you out. Pluto square ascendant people therefore seem to always have an air of mystery and intimidation around them. Since Pluto is the planet of transformation , deep meaning and also violence , the challenging aspect to the ascendant seem to get you in undesirable situation where sometimes violence can break out. People tend to be either fascinated by you ( especially for those who also enjoy a deep meaningful contact ) , or they would dislike you due to the same reason.

This contact between ASC and Pluto offers a very strong personality and a fixed nature where you tend stick to your decision regardless of the change of circumstances. You therefore are often admired for strong determination and conviction. However , this aspect also indicates high jealousy , controlling and suspicious nature , even to those who are closer to you. Be careful not to let this challenging aspect get out of hand as it can make you go towards a more downside , underhanded ways of dealing with things of Pluto. This aspect, if used right, can offer you good benefits , for one you would be very good at detecting all the hidden things, be able to dig deep into difficult matters and get more profound and meaningful outcomes out of them.

Sometimes the interpretations can be a bit discouraging though. Let me quote Robert Pelletier's awesome aspect book:

quote:
Pluto square the Ascendant shows that you feel you are destined to have a powerful influence on the lives of the people you contact. Overly impressed with your righteousness, you feel that you alone can properly control their affairs. Nothing you observe is ever to your satisfaction, so you want to make alterations to suit yourself. Apparently your early training led you to assume that the world was waiting for you to grow up and restore order to it. With such an incredible belief in your own omnipotence, you are sure to run into major problems with those who have authority over you.

A major issue in your life will be learning to accept traditional chains of command, especially in organizations. You make arrogant display of showmanship by assuming command that doesn't belong to you. This quality is extremely irritating to those who have to deal with you. This behavior is probably a direct reaction to your feeling that your parents or guardians had supreme authority over you. Because of this, you became insensitive to the way people react when you assert yourself. You often show bad judgment in making decisions, but because you are convinced that no one should question what you do, you persist even when error is quite obvious. You have a lot to learn about how much pressure people will tolerate from you.

Once you learn how to exercise good judgment, you can truly achieve greatness with your skillful ability to organize others to achieve your objectives. You are gifted in maintaining composure under trying conditions, and you never back down when challenged, even by the most competent adversaries.

You may have trouble in personal relationships because your demands are sometimes oppressive. Your lust for power and recognition seeps into all your affairs, so that compromise is nearly impossible.
